Understanding the Steaming Process

Before we dive into the specifics of how long to steam fresh zucchini, it’s important to understand the steaming process. Steaming is a method of cooking that involves using water vapor to cook food. The steam circulates around the food, ensuring even cooking without adding excess fat or calories. When steaming zucchini, the goal is to cook it until it’s tender but still firm, with a slightly glossy appearance.

Factors Affecting Steaming Time

The time it takes to steam fresh zucchini can vary depending on several factors, including the size of the zucchini, the thickness of the slices, and the steaming method used. Here are some key factors to consider:

1. Size: Larger zucchini will take longer to steam than smaller ones. If you’re using larger zucchini, you may need to increase the steaming time by a few minutes.
2. Thickness: Thicker slices of zucchini will take longer to cook than thinner slices. To ensure even cooking, slice your zucchini into uniform thickness.
3. Steaming Method: The type of steamer you use can also affect the cooking time. A steamer basket that fits snugly over a pot with boiling water will cook zucchini faster than a steamer that’s not as well-sealed.

How Long to Steam Fresh Zucchini

Based on the factors mentioned above, here’s a general guideline for steaming fresh zucchini:

– For whole zucchini: Steam for about 5-7 minutes, or until the zucchini is tender when pierced with a fork.
– For sliced zucchini: Steam for about 3-5 minutes, depending on the thickness of the slices.
– For zucchini spears: Steam for about 2-3 minutes.

Remember to adjust the cooking time based on the size and thickness of your zucchini, as well as the type of steamer you’re using.
